Do RVs need insurance in Florida?

Florida state law requires insurance on motorized RVs that you drive, as opposed to one that you tow. Drivable RVs need liability, comprehensive, and collision coverage just like an automobile. There are no insurance requirements for trailers that are towed behind your vehicle in Florida.

How much does it cost to register an RV in Florida?

Motor Vehicle Registration Fees

Motorcycles $10.00
Recreational Vehicles (camping trailer) $13.50
Recreational Vehicles (under 4,500lbs) $27.00
Recreational Vehicles (over 4,500 lbs) $47.50

Are RVs expensive to maintain?

Maintenance and repairs for your RV can be costly, too. Maintenance costs depend on the wear and tear of your RV. According to Mobile Homes Parts Store, several people who lived in RVs said they spent between $500 and $1,000 a year on maintenance costs. Some RVers spent several thousand dollars a year.
